
Gov. Mai Mala Buni of Yobe has directed the State Emergency Management Agency (SEMA) to provide immediate relief to communities affected by heavy downpour in Potiskum on Friday.
Dr Mohammed Goje, Executive Secretary of SEMA, told newsmen in Potiskum that the agency received an emergency alert in the early hours of Friday and promptly activated field teams for rapid assessment and intervention.
He said no loss of life had been recorded at the time of filing this report.
Goje listed the affected areas as Old Prison, Filin Mashe, Unguwar Makafi, Unguwar Jaje Bakin Kwari, Afghanistan, Tsangaya, Karofi, Bayan Garejin Dan Juma, Jigawa Bayan, Makarahuta, and Tandari.
“The detailed assessment is ongoing and the government will ensure that life-saving support, protection, and immediate relief are provided to all affected persons,” he said.
The executive secretary reiterated the governor’s commitment to safeguarding the lives and property of residents, and urged communities to remain vigilant during the rainy season and promptly report emergencies to relevant authorities.
